Paul Zuehlcke
a1d23766c7
Bug 1596897 - Moved permission list from site identity to separate permission panel. r=johannh
...
- Added a new permission panel managed by the gPermissionPanel object
- Updated identity-box to separate identity and permission section
Differential Revision: https://phabricator.services.mozilla.com/D99892
2021-02-05 13:40:35 +00:00
Adam Gashlin
f1af889cc7
Bug 1660198 - Part 2: Record installation telemetry event. r=bytesized
...
Differential Revision: https://phabricator.services.mozilla.com/D103242
2021-01-30 00:00:26 +00:00
Narcis Beleuzu
926d2f6257
Backed out 2 changesets (bug 1596897) for bc failures on browser_search_discovery.js
...
Backed out changeset 635972f169e7 (bug 1596897)
Backed out changeset a84b667007e2 (bug 1596897)
2021-01-30 04:01:21 +02:00
Paul Zuehlcke
480794a586
Bug 1596897 - Moved permission list from site identity to separate permission panel. r=johannh
...
- Added a new permission panel managed by the gPermissionPanel object
- Updated identity-box to separate identity and permission section
Differential Revision: https://phabricator.services.mozilla.com/D99892
2021-01-29 16:06:08 +00:00
Drew Willcoxon
2dd0131936
Bug 1688786 - Add a browser.urlbar.showSearchSuggestionsFirst pref. r=mak,preferences-reviewers
...
Introduce a new `browser.urlbar.showSearchSuggestionsFirst` boolean pref that
determines whether search suggestions are shown before general results.
This keeps the `matchBuckets` pref. I could have removed it since the only thing
we're using it for right now is to tell whether suggestions are shown first. The
reason I didn't remove it is because ultimately we do want a `matchBuckets` or
`resultBuckets` pref so we can experiment with different results compositions
using simple pref-flip studies. Hopefully bug 1676469 will land soon and we'll
replace `matchBuckets` with `resultBuckets`, but in the meantime I think we
should keep `matchBuckets` around.
This also removes some `browser.urlbar.matchBuckets` assignments in tests that
don't actually depend on it. For tests that do depend on it, I changed them so
they set `showSearchSuggestionsFirst` now.
Differential Revision: https://phabricator.services.mozilla.com/D103137
2021-01-28 23:23:16 +00:00
Kris Maglione
caf1d0e771
Bug 1685801: Part 6 - Move some front-end code from BrowserUtils to a separate module. r=mccr8
...
Differential Revision: https://phabricator.services.mozilla.com/D101486
2021-01-28 20:58:43 +00:00
Kris Maglione
0e0cc35418
Bug 1685801: Part 2 - Move site origin telemetry to separate module. r=mccr8
...
Differential Revision: https://phabricator.services.mozilla.com/D101482
2021-01-28 20:58:26 +00:00
Mihai Alexandru Michis
e10f79168a
Backed out 12 changesets (bug 1685801) for causing bc failures in browser_ctrlTab.js
...
CLOSED TREE
Backed out changeset 021924b62f13 (bug 1685801)
Backed out changeset 38cc10101c1f (bug 1685801)
Backed out changeset 9ab9574ac72a (bug 1685801)
Backed out changeset 1a7f259cc2ec (bug 1685801)
Backed out changeset b267b19a7f6e (bug 1685801)
Backed out changeset 7dfcf0257487 (bug 1685801)
Backed out changeset ee0d0169b079 (bug 1685801)
Backed out changeset 0c358ee51951 (bug 1685801)
Backed out changeset 338ab91af557 (bug 1685801)
Backed out changeset a49415007aaf (bug 1685801)
Backed out changeset b91098299143 (bug 1685801)
Backed out changeset edf6209861a8 (bug 1685801)
2021-01-28 22:55:11 +02:00
Brindusan Cristian
b0f9bc02f2
Backed out 2 changesets (bug 1596897) for mochitest failures at browser_setIgnoreCertificateErrors.js. CLOSED TREE
...
Backed out changeset 00c45a405129 (bug 1596897)
Backed out changeset 61304ccbaada (bug 1596897)
2021-01-28 21:53:46 +02:00
Kris Maglione
2d5f151948
Bug 1685801: Part 6 - Move some front-end code from BrowserUtils to a separate module. r=mccr8
...
Differential Revision: https://phabricator.services.mozilla.com/D101486
2021-01-28 05:25:03 +00:00
Kris Maglione
bcc444068f
Bug 1685801: Part 2 - Move site origin telemetry to separate module. r=mccr8
...
Differential Revision: https://phabricator.services.mozilla.com/D101482
2021-01-28 18:48:25 +00:00
Paul Zuehlcke
032c94dfc0
Bug 1596897 - Moved permission list from site identity to separate permission panel. r=johannh
...
- Added a new permission panel managed by the gPermissionPanel object
- Updated identity-box to separate identity and permission section
Differential Revision: https://phabricator.services.mozilla.com/D99892
2021-01-28 18:00:44 +00:00
Butkovits Atila
91af0d3269
Backed out 12 changesets (bug 1685801) for causing failures on browser_fission_maxOrigins.js. CLOSED TREE
...
Backed out changeset 0d7153110519 (bug 1685801)
Backed out changeset 5175062925c7 (bug 1685801)
Backed out changeset 2c1250e786f0 (bug 1685801)
Backed out changeset 0ce3c773ba74 (bug 1685801)
Backed out changeset 9d51c6e24dee (bug 1685801)
Backed out changeset 3f4dc6349441 (bug 1685801)
Backed out changeset a80de9abb9f8 (bug 1685801)
Backed out changeset 30786893a5e7 (bug 1685801)
Backed out changeset 8007b12d6e32 (bug 1685801)
Backed out changeset fa814f4b7125 (bug 1685801)
Backed out changeset 14e4e47ee99f (bug 1685801)
Backed out changeset d9f1feba9454 (bug 1685801)
2021-01-28 07:15:59 +02:00
Kris Maglione
cebae4d59b
Bug 1685801: Part 6 - Move some front-end code from BrowserUtils to a separate module. r=mccr8
...
Differential Revision: https://phabricator.services.mozilla.com/D101486
2021-01-28 03:32:43 +00:00
Kris Maglione
aeba9a5a38
Bug 1685801: Part 2 - Move site origin telemetry to separate module. r=mccr8
...
Differential Revision: https://phabricator.services.mozilla.com/D101482
2021-01-28 03:32:30 +00:00
Emma Malysz
d0b6faeb3f
Bug 1688700, add items to proton app menu r=fluent-reviewers,mconley,flod
...
Differential Revision: https://phabricator.services.mozilla.com/D103090
2021-01-28 00:29:29 +00:00
Butkovits Atila
8c475e952f
Backed out changeset 9226bc3ca03c (bug 1688700) for causing failures on browser_preferences_usage.js.
2021-01-28 01:09:22 +02:00
Emma Malysz
8df3985aae
Bug 1688700, add items to proton app menu r=fluent-reviewers,mconley,flod
...
Differential Revision: https://phabricator.services.mozilla.com/D103090
2021-01-27 21:18:20 +00:00
Butkovits Atila
8d8e1d7513
Backed out changeset cc398c4ac5c8 (bug 1688700) for causing mochitest failures. CLOSED TREE
2021-01-27 22:59:12 +02:00
Emma Malysz
807732f441
Bug 1688700, add items to proton app menu r=fluent-reviewers,mconley,flod
...
Differential Revision: https://phabricator.services.mozilla.com/D103090
2021-01-27 19:58:22 +00:00
Barret Rennie
9f5625d4fc
Bug 1688078 - Collect snapshot of content processes r=jesup
...
Differential Revision: https://phabricator.services.mozilla.com/D102682
2021-01-27 15:38:08 +00:00
Mark Banner
8a9fc4165b
Bug 1687235 - Enable ESLint rule no-setter-return for browser/. r=mossop,preferences-reviewers
...
Differential Revision: https://phabricator.services.mozilla.com/D102152
2021-01-26 13:42:38 +00:00
Brindusan Cristian
201069fdac
Backed out 5 changesets (bug 1687235) for mochitest failures at test_menulist_null_value.xhtml. CLOSED TREE
...
Backed out changeset 638c802ca1d1 (bug 1687235 )
Backed out changeset ec830b771bce (bug 1687235 )
Backed out changeset a7c933ddecfd (bug 1687235 )
Backed out changeset c36493fb0599 (bug 1687235 )
Backed out changeset 6eb33ad5d460 (bug 1687235 )
2021-01-26 10:58:43 +02:00
Mark Banner
36cf48f89d
Bug 1687235 - Enable ESLint rule no-setter-return for browser/. r=mossop,preferences-reviewers
...
Differential Revision: https://phabricator.services.mozilla.com/D102152
2021-01-25 22:27:19 +00:00
Kirk Steuber
e11fcb7187
Bug 1685594 - Add capability for turning off automatic application update checks r=agashlin,preferences-reviewers
...
Note that this does not add the policy necessary to enable this feature. That policy will be added in Bug 1653430
Differential Revision: https://phabricator.services.mozilla.com/D101251
2021-01-21 23:47:19 +00:00
Mark Banner
9620ab0367
Bug 1513680 - Remove remaining references to ContentSearch.jsm. r=daleharvey
...
Depends on D102226
Differential Revision: https://phabricator.services.mozilla.com/D102227
2021-01-22 08:31:03 +00:00
Gijs Kruitbosch
bf7c7fb0c2
Bug 1686816 - ensure we have useful values for waitCount and deselectCount to avoid 'undefined' showing up in telemetry, r=jaws
...
Unfortunately a meaningful automated test here is difficult because we're dealing with shutdown.
Differential Revision: https://phabricator.services.mozilla.com/D102598
2021-01-21 16:42:21 +00:00
Brindusan Cristian
b73fb94aed
Backed out changeset 102b2b2b5a4c (bug 1687341) as requested by mconley on irc. CLOSED TREE
2021-01-21 17:59:03 +02:00
Neil Deakin
51bac25eb5
Bug 1644911, add notification bar when a subframe crashes that allows submitting a crash report, r=mconley,fluent-reviewers,flod
...
Differential Revision: https://phabricator.services.mozilla.com/D97346
2021-01-21 08:44:51 +00:00
Emma Malysz
1de8d84ac5
Bug 1687703, add a preference to see if ctrl-tab is used r=mstriemer
...
Differential Revision: https://phabricator.services.mozilla.com/D102496
2021-01-20 23:27:51 +00:00
Emma Malysz
530a7ecafa
Bug 1687341, checkbox should be checked by default for Geolocation permission prompt r=mconley
...
Differential Revision: https://phabricator.services.mozilla.com/D102364
2021-01-20 20:49:05 +00:00
Anny Gakhokidze
465bfe416d
Bug 1630908 - Part 1: Pass OriginAttributes to be included with remote type, r=nika,marionette-reviewers
...
Differential Revision: https://phabricator.services.mozilla.com/D101073
2021-01-19 22:23:29 +00:00
Emma Malysz
4e102a1a9d
Bug 1686766, add preference to track if user interacts with library button r=Gijs
...
Differential Revision: https://phabricator.services.mozilla.com/D102072
2021-01-18 15:39:11 +00:00
Neil Deakin
5a377a1791
Bug 1684792, open form validation popup anchored at screen coordinate as datetime picker and select do so that it is positioned correctly in out of process iframes, r=Gijs
...
Differential Revision: https://phabricator.services.mozilla.com/D100803
2021-01-15 15:25:44 +00:00
Dave Townsend
b34b8cb330
Bug 1682593: Remove the site specific browser feature. r=Gijs
...
Differential Revision: https://phabricator.services.mozilla.com/D101860
2021-01-15 11:11:19 +00:00
Butkovits Atila
14aa32e385
Backed out changeset f866f5dc0058 (bug 1684792) for causing failure on browser/browser_edit.js.
2021-01-15 12:53:57 +02:00
Neil Deakin
80be4631cf
Bug 1684792, open form validation popup anchored at screen coordinate as datetime picker and select do so that it is positioned correctly in out of process iframes, r=Gijs
...
Differential Revision: https://phabricator.services.mozilla.com/D100803
2021-01-15 00:15:17 +00:00
Razvan Maries
8b8a7527f8
Backed out changeset f901a3b75b79 (bug 1684792) for perma failures on browser_edit.js. CLOSED TREE
2021-01-12 11:56:35 +02:00
Neil Deakin
07f6ff2312
Bug 1684792, open form validation popup anchored at screen coordinate as datetime picker and select do so that it is positioned correctly in out of process iframes, r=Gijs
...
Differential Revision: https://phabricator.services.mozilla.com/D100803
2021-01-11 20:11:41 +00:00
Mark Banner
45ccfee537
Bug 1685124 - Ensure search engine settings are saved before reloading engines. r=daleharvey
...
Differential Revision: https://phabricator.services.mozilla.com/D101032
2021-01-10 22:33:11 +00:00
Paul Zuehlcke
c5c0efa1bd
Bug 1685306 - Enable dFPI MVP UI pref by default. r=nhnt11
...
Differential Revision: https://phabricator.services.mozilla.com/D100920
2021-01-08 16:32:52 +00:00
Andreea Pavel
ce15e80311
Bug 1680672 - disable browser_PermissionUI.js on win, linux and mac debug r=intermittent-reviewers,jmaher
...
Differential Revision: https://phabricator.services.mozilla.com/D100559
2021-01-05 14:23:45 +00:00
Daisuke Akatsuka
e540566098
Bug 1678606: Remove onClearHistory interface from nsINavHistoryService. r=mixedpuppy,mak
...
Depends on D99751
Differential Revision: https://phabricator.services.mozilla.com/D99752
2020-12-23 11:15:20 +00:00
Daisuke Akatsuka
0675b8e87e
Bug 1678606: Apply history-cleared event instead of onClearHistory. r=mixedpuppy,mak
...
Depends on D99750
Differential Revision: https://phabricator.services.mozilla.com/D99751
2020-12-23 10:21:54 +00:00
harry
a3423e2d45
Bug 1680019 - Split campaign IDs from the partnerlink.attributionURL pref. r=Standard8
...
This is a minimal set of changes to allow us to run the weather experiment. By splitting campaign IDs from the attributionURL pref, the weather extension can read the attributionURL pref and append its own CID. I didn't make any changes to the design of search engines or top sites; we met today and decided those needed more careful consideration before we make major changes to PartnerLinkAttribution.
Differential Revision: https://phabricator.services.mozilla.com/D100055
2020-12-21 18:42:46 +00:00
Butkovits Atila
7b6a024895
Backed out changeset 6e58c931a044 (bug 1680019) for casuing failure at sandbox-navigation-timing.tentative.html. CLOSED TREE
2020-12-21 22:48:53 +02:00
harry
e120ac8a21
Bug 1680019 - Split campaign IDs from the partnerlink.attributionURL pref. r=Standard8
...
This is a minimal set of changes to allow us to run the weather experiment. By splitting campaign IDs from the attributionURL pref, the weather extension can read the attributionURL pref and append its own CID. I didn't make any changes to the design of search engines or top sites; we met today and decided those needed more careful consideration before we make major changes to PartnerLinkAttribution.
Differential Revision: https://phabricator.services.mozilla.com/D100055
2020-12-21 18:42:46 +00:00
Kirk Steuber
e5a274ddd2
Bug 353804 - Add update swap handling to UpdateListener and AppUpdater r=mhowell
...
UpdateListener and AppUpdater need to know when a downloading update is transitioning to being a ready update so they don't prompt the user to restart Firefox while updates are still staging (which would result in them not being installed).
Differential Revision: https://phabricator.services.mozilla.com/D95821
2020-12-18 20:57:22 +00:00
Daisuke Akatsuka
880d92c660
Bug 1678611: Remove onTitleChanged interface from nsINavHistoryService. r=mak,mixedpuppy
...
Depends on D98280
Differential Revision: https://phabricator.services.mozilla.com/D98281
2020-12-18 07:25:49 +00:00
Marco Bonardo
2cce82871d
Bug 1665049 - Remove browser.urlbar.update2.oneOffsRefresh. r=harry
...
Differential Revision: https://phabricator.services.mozilla.com/D99793
2020-12-18 09:58:17 +00:00